Seeed Studio XIAO ESP32-C3 – Ultra Compact WiFi & Bluetooth IoT Development Board
The Seeed Studio XIAO ESP32-C3 is an ultra compact and powerful IoT development board built around the ESP32-C3 RISC-V processor. Designed for students, embedded developers, robotics enthusiasts, IoT engineers, and electronics makers in Bangladesh, this board delivers 2.4GHz WiFi, Bluetooth 5 (BLE), USB Type-C connectivity, low power operation, and Arduino compatibility in an extremely small footprint.
Whether you are building smart home automation, sensor nodes, wearable electronics, wireless monitoring systems, ESPHome projects, industrial IoT prototypes, robotics, or battery-powered applications, the XIAO ESP32-C3 offers professional performance with beginner friendly development.
Its tiny size makes it ideal for projects where space matters while maintaining compatibility with modern development ecosystems including Arduino IDE, PlatformIO, ESP-IDF, MicroPython and TinyML experimentation.

Specifications:
| Specification | Details |
|---|---|
| Product Name | Seeed Studio XIAO ESP32-C3 |
| MCU | ESP32-C3 |
| CPU Architecture | 32-bit RISC-V |
| Wireless | WiFi 2.4GHz + Bluetooth 5 (BLE) |
| Flash Memory | 4MB |
| USB Interface | USB Type-C |
| Operating Voltage | 3.3V |
| GPIO Pins | Multiple multifunction GPIO |
| Communication | UART, SPI, I2C |
| Analog Support | ADC |
| PWM | Supported |
| Development Platform | Arduino IDE, ESP-IDF, PlatformIO |
| Power Modes | Active / Deep Sleep |
| Form Factor | XIAO Ultra Compact |
